Claustre

D 51 completed
Cli Tool
web_app / rust · small
94
Files
35,202
LOC
1
Frameworks
8
Languages

Pipeline State

completed
Run ID
#370785
Phase
done
Progress
1%
Started
Finished
2026-04-13 01:31:02
LLM tokens
0

Pipeline Metadata

Stage
Cataloged
Decision
proceed
Novelty
69.80
Framework unique
Isolation
Last stage change
2026-05-10 03:35:31
Deduplication group #50682
Member of a group with 1 similar repo(s) — this repo is canonical view group →
Top concepts (2)
Project DescriptionWeb Frontend
Repobility · severity-and-effort ranking · https://repobility.com

AI Prompt

Build me a Terminal User Interface (TUI) application in Rust that acts as a centralized dashboard for managing multiple Claude Code sessions across different projects. The tool should allow users to add projects, create tasks with a title, description, and mode (supervised or autonomous), and launch these tasks. Key features to include are monitoring the real-time status of tasks (like working, in_review, or done), handling session isolation using git worktrees, and providing navigation controls similar to Vim. It should also support opening associated Pull Requests in the browser and marking tasks as done.
rust tui cli terminal ai-assistant workflow claude rust-lang dashboard
Generated by gemma4:latest

Catalog Information

Claustre is a TUI for orchestrating multiple Claude Code sessions across projects, providing a centralized dashboard to manage AI-assisted development workflows.

Description

Claustre is a command-line interface (CLI) tool that allows users to manage and orchestrate multiple Claude Code sessions across different projects. It provides a centralized dashboard for managing AI-assisted development workflows, using features such as git worktrees for session isolation, embedded PTY terminals for live session management, and Claude Code hooks for real-time status sync.

الوصف

هو أداة CLI تسمح للمستخدمين بمراقبة وتخطيط العديد من جلسات كلود كود عبر مشاريع مختلفة. يوفّر لوحة تحكم مركزية لتنظيم تدفقات التطوير المسلّطة بالذكاء الاصطناعي، باستخدام ميزات مثل العملات git للفصل بين الجلسات، وواجهات PTY المدمجة للتحكم في الجلسات على الوقت الحقيقي، وكود كلود للاستجابة في الوقت الحقيقي.

Novelty

7/10

Tags

orchestration ai-assisted-development workflow-management session-isolation live-session-management

Technologies

serde

Claude Models

claude-opus-4.6

Quality Score

D
51.3/100
Structure
53
Code Quality
39
Documentation
69
Testing
15
Practices
72
Security
76
Dependencies
60

Strengths

  • CI/CD pipeline configured (github_actions)
  • Consistent naming conventions (snake_case)
  • Properly licensed project

Weaknesses

  • No tests found \u2014 high risk of regressions
  • 3964 duplicate lines detected \u2014 consider DRY refactoring
  • 7 'god files' with >500 LOC need decomposition

Recommendations

  • Add a test suite \u2014 start with critical path integration tests
  • Add a linter configuration to enforce code style consistency

Security & Health

8.3h
Tech Debt (A)
A
OWASP (100%)
PASS
Quality Gate
A
Risk (1)
Citation: Repobility (2026). State of AI-Generated Code. https://repobility.com/research/
MIT
License
7.2%
Duplication
Full Security Report AI Fix Prompts SARIF SBOM

Languages

rust
43.4%
markdown
34.8%
json
20.4%
yaml
0.4%
shell
0.4%
css
0.4%
toml
0.1%
javascript
0.1%

Frameworks

Astro

Concepts (2)

Source-of-truth: Repobility · https://repobility.com
CategoryNameDescriptionConfidence
Repobility — same analyzer, your code, free for public repos · /scan/
auto_descriptionProject DescriptionA TUI for orchestrating multiple Claude Code sessions across projects.80%
auto_categoryWeb Frontendweb-frontend70%

Quality Timeline

1 quality score recorded.

View File Metrics

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/94992.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V